Threshold and timeout — what the 1.67V and 560ms mean for the rail

The 1.67V threshold is the exact trip point for the monitored supply. If the rail dips below that level, the active-low RESET output (open-drain) pulls low immediately. The 560ms minimum reset timeout starts when the rail recovers above the threshold — this debounce window holds the processor in reset long enough for the oscillator and PLL to stabilise before code execution begins. Single-channel monitoring means one package watches one voltage rail. For a 1.8V core supply or a 1.8V I/O bank, the 1.67V threshold sits about 130 mV below nominal — close enough to catch a brownout before logic corruption, but not so tight that normal ripple triggers false resets.
